Role Overview
Zutari is seeking a detail-oriented and proactiveMaterials Inspectorto support the delivery of high-quality infrastructure and built environment projects. The role is responsible for inspecting sampling and verifying construction materials and related works to ensure compliance with approved specifications project quality requirements and applicable standards.
The successful candidate will work closely with site supervision contractors laboratories and quality teams to help ensure that materials incorporated into the works are fit for purpose properly documented and aligned with project requirements. This role is important to maintaining quality reducing rework and supporting safe sustainable project delivery.
Responsibilities
Carry out routine site inspections sampling and testing of construction materials to confirm compliance with approved material submittals project specifications and relevant standards.
Inspect delivered materials review supporting documentation and verify identification certification and traceability before acceptance for use on site.
Identify record and report non-conforming materials and support the resolution process in coordination with the project team.
Witness and monitor sampling and testing activities for materials such as soils aggregates asphalt concrete steel water and utility-related products in accordance with inspection and test plans.
Inspect material-related aspects of civil and infrastructure works including roadworks concrete works reinforcement structural steel drainage utilities and associated components.
Review material storage handling preservation and protection practices at site stores laydown areas and stockyards.
Maintain accurate inspection records sampling registers testing logs and related quality documentation.
Support the preparation of site reports quality observations and non-conformance records where required.
Liaise effectively with resident engineers site engineers contractors laboratories health and safety teams and quality personnel to support coordinated project delivery.
Promote compliance with project quality health and safety and environmental requirements at all times.
